Australia Visa Refusal? Here's How to Contest

Received a visa rejection from the Land Down Under ? Don't panic just yet! You might have the right to challenge the ruling. The process involves meticulously reviewing the justifications for the rejection , collecting any relevant proof, and then presenting a formal application to the Administrative Appeals Tribunal (AAT) . You is strongly advised to seek expert migration guidance to improve your prospects of a favorable outcome. Remember, there are strict periods for lodging an review, so act quickly!
